Python基礎學習之標識符
阿新 • • 發佈:2017-05-08
數字 其他 符號 lin port 分用 xxx rom code
1、合法的Python標識符
Python標識符字符串規則和其他大部分用C編寫的高級語言相似:
- 第一個字符必須是字母或下劃線(_)
- 剩下的字符可以是字母和數字或下滑線
- 大小寫敏感
標識符不能以數字開頭;除了下劃線,其他的符號都不允許使用。
2、關鍵字
1 >>> import keyword 2 >>> print(keyword.kwlist) 3 [‘False‘, ‘None‘, ‘True‘, ‘and‘, ‘as‘, ‘assert‘,
‘break‘, ‘class‘, ‘continue‘, ‘def‘, ‘del‘, ‘elif‘,
‘else‘, ‘except‘, ‘finally‘, ‘for‘, ‘from‘, ‘global‘,
‘if‘, ‘import‘, ‘in‘, ‘is‘, ‘lambda‘, ‘nonlocal‘, ‘not‘,
‘or‘, ‘pass‘, ‘raise‘, ‘return‘, ‘try‘, ‘while‘, ‘with‘,
‘yield‘]
3、專用下劃線標識符
Python用下劃線作為變量前綴和後綴制定特殊變量。
- 一般來講_xxx被看做是私有的,在模塊或類外不可以使用。
- __xxx__ 系統定義名字
- __ 類中私有變量名。
避免用下劃線做為變量名的開始!
Python基礎學習之標識符